Output 2c99845e930a663f656201fcee86204944360a9ae4e0977dbd60ce4d50921d94:0

value
38366871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95ebb9a4d6de0e3dc33c44efd9867ca5f725c090 OP_EQUALVERIFY OP_CHECKSIG
address
1Efi54BHevL3inVXK2yYCxzAxsvQ46oRRA
transaction
2c99845e930a663f656201fcee86204944360a9ae4e0977dbd60ce4d50921d94
spent
true